Implements an efficient estimator of bid-ask spreads from open, high, low, and close prices as described in Ardia, Guidotti, & Kroencke (2021).
Install this package with:
install.packages("bidask")
Load the library:
library("bidask")
Arguments:
edge(open, high, low, close, sign=FALSE)
field | description |
---|---|
open |
Numeric vector of open prices |
high |
Numeric vector of high prices |
low |
Numeric vector of low prices |
close |
Numeric vector of close prices |
sign |
Whether signed estimates should be returned |
The input prices must be sorted in ascending order of the timestamp.
The output value is the spread estimate. A value of 0.01 corresponds to a spread of 1%.
